A Sugar Hill man died Thursday in a single-vehicle motorcycle accident along Ga. 20 in Gwinnett County, near the Forsyth County line, but Gwinnett County Police are unsure when exactly the accident happened.
Nathan M. Vise, 28, was ejected when his motorcycle left the roadway and hit a guide wire that was supporting a pole about half a mile west of Burnette Trail, and subsequently fell down an embankment, where he died, said Cpl. Wilbert Rundles, Gwinnett County Police spokesman, in an interview with AccessWDUN.
Investigators are working to determine if speed or alcohol played a role in the crash, which doesn't appear to involved any other vehicles, said Rundles.
Police were first called to the scene when a passerby noticed the accident around 2 p.m.
What's unclear, said Rundles, is when the accident actually happened and how long Vise' body might have been there.
